Designing Low-Noise, High-Linearity and High-Speed Preamplifiers for Magnetic Transducers

An ultra-low-noise preamplifier front end configuration is determined through the analysis of the noise behaviour of a bipolar transistor, current mirror and an FET in relation to the noise performance of various preamplifier configurations. A design for Hi-Fi performance, in accordance with the demand for a low-noise, high-linearity and high-speed preamplifier for use with a magnetic transducer, is then presented.
